You should change it at some interval. The fluid is hydroscopic so water forms in the system and res which is not a good thing.

If its Dot3 id flush and go with dot4. If dot 4 already id do it around 100k unless its very dirty. Dot 3 and 4 are hydroscopic, but the braking system is a sealed system so unless u take your cap off the master cylinder every night theoretically theres no way for moisture to enter the system
